Sickness bug at Highbridge School

The highly contagious Hand, Foot and Mouth viral illness has broken out at a Highbridge School, we can confirm.

Burnham-On-Sea.com learns that a pupil at St John's School in Highbridge had the bug and has now returned to school having fully recovered.

A newsletter which was sent to all parents this week includes a warning and advice about the bug, as pictured below.

The disease begins with a fever, poor appetite, and after two days painful sores develop in the mouth, followed by a rash.
